What they do

A General Manager manages all aspects of a business. May be responsible for managing a small business, or managing one division or department of a larger business. Oversees administration, finance, communication and marketing as well as operations for a company. Reports to business owners, executive management or a board of directors.

Job Description

We are seeking an experienced General Manager with hands-on production experience working with hazardous materials and SDS requirements in a chemical or similar regulated setting. This General Manager will provide strategic and operational leadership across production, warehouse, inventory, and fulfillment functions, be responsible for driving operational efficiency, maintaining strong safety culture, developing high-performing teams, and supporting the continued growth and scalability of the organization. The ideal candidate will review financial performance and KPIs, coach/manage operations managers/supervisors, assume full responsibility for operational budgeting and P&L, and ensure own site OSHA compliance while keeping the lines running safely and efficiently. What you get to work on daily
  • Lead and continuously improve operational systems, workflows, processes, and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s).
  • Promote and maintain a strong culture of workplace safety while ensuring compliance with OSHA regulations and other applicable requirements.
  • Oversee inventory accuracy, inventory control, fulfillment activities, and material movement throughout the operation.
  • Develop workforce plans to effectively manage seasonal fluctuations, staffing demands, and changing business needs.
  • Establish, monitor, and analyze key performance indicators (KPIs) to drive accountability, productivity, and continuous improvement.
  • Recruit, coach, mentor, and develop team members while building a collaborative and high-performing leadership team.
  • Identify operational challenges and implement scalable solutions that support organizational growth.
  • Maintain familiarity with RF-scanning Warehouse Management Systems (WMS) and bin-location inventory practices.
  • Remain actively involved in hands-on production operations, including working around automated production lines and supporting floor-level operational needs.
  • Ensure appropriate procedures are followed for hazardous materials and Safety Data Sheet (SDS) management within a chemical environment.
  • Oversee the safe operation and certification programs associated with warehouse equipment, including turret, reach, and counter-balance forklifts.
